People may not know about meaning of red roses but there are lots of significations to it. It is the meaning of love and desire. By screening films it will lead you to true love and desire that is made with various genres and various cinematic techniques and edits. These films allow getting closer with audience emotionally with desire that all human has. Program includes digital film and 16mm films. -KHK
